When the trade that brought future Hall of Fame big man Kevin Garnett to the Boston Celtics in the summer of 2007 was complete, the energy in the city of Boston and beyond surrounding the Celtics was palpable. The storied franchise had endured an extended period of time as a mediocre to bad ball club between their last era of contention under legendary small forward Larry Bird. It did have a few solid seasons in the early aughts, with Paul Pierce and Antoine Walker making some postseason noise, though. Hurricane Ernesto is Gaining Strength: How Will It Affect Maine, New Hampshire, & Massachusetts?
Until recently, New England rarely had to worry about tropical storms and hurricanes. Over the last few years, we have seen that change, though. In September 2023, we had to deal with a pair of back-to-back storms. While those storms had lost much of their strength by the time they reached New England, they did hit us within days of each other. And after dealing with Debby last weekend, we are getting ready to deal with Ernesto this weekend.

Champion of Latino leaders in Mass., Cesar Ruiz, must regroup after sanction (Editorial)
Cesar Ruiz, a prominent Western Massachusetts businessman, just got an expensive lesson in campaign finance law. His wish to support Hispanic and Latino candidates for office must no longer violate state rules on how money flows to candidates. Cash he planned to give to candidates, $190,000 worth, will instead benefit charities.

Healey Told to Vacate as Massachusetts State House to Close
The Massachusetts State House is closing, forcing employees and elected officials including Governor Maura Healey to find somewhere else to earn their keep. The historic gold-domed state capitol building that sits high atop Beacon Hill in Boston was damaged in a two-alarm fire on July 18, 2023 and must close for repairs. That will happen this month.
